Lithuania Lowest Military Spending

0.45% in 1995
Military expenditure as % of GDP · World Bank

The lowest military spending in Lithuania was 0.45% in 1995. The top 5 years were: 1995 (0.45%), 1994 (0.49%), 1996 (0.50%), 1997 (0.74%), 2013 (0.77%).
